Glutton is a Trait in Remnant 2. Glutton is a Trait that allows your character to benefit from Consumables and Relics more swiftly by significantly increasing their Use Speed.
Remnant 2 Glutton Trait Effect
Glutton is a Trait that provides the following effect:
-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ics
- At max level, Glutton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+35%
- Note: Updated with the release of The Forgotten Kingdom DLC. Check Patch Notes for more information.
Where to find Glutton in Remnant 2
Glutton can be found:
You need to complete The Feast Event in multiplayer. Attempting to resurrect a fallen ally while under the Ravenous status grants this trait to character that decides to eat an ally. Food on the table inflicts the status and starts the event.
Remnant 2 Glutton Trait Levels
Glutton upgrades its effect as you level up your Archetype, or spend more Trait Points in it. Note that for any Archetype Trait that reaches max level (Level 10), players can unlock that trait for any archetype from the archetype page, without needing to equip its respective Engram.
Level |
Bonus |
Level 1 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+3% |
Level 2 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+6% |
Level 3 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+9% |
Level 4 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+12% |
Level 5 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+15% |
Level 6 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+18% |
Level 7 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+21% |
Level 8 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+24% |
Level 9 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+27% |
Level 10 | Increases the Use Speed of Consumables and Relics by +35% |

Remnant 2 Glutton Notes & Trivia
- Traits are unique passive abilities that provide bonuses and buffs to a player. There are three types of Traits in the game.
- Core Traits are common for all four Classes, and are unlocked as soon as you begin the game.
- Archetype or Class Traits, are locked behind their respective Archetypes, and only one can be equipped one at a time, unless you have the ability to combine any two of your Archetypes.
- The third type, called simply Traits can be equipped by any Class, but have to be unlocked. Unique Archetype Traits can be leveled up as you level up the corresponding Archetype. On the other hand, the rest require Trait Points in order to be upgraded. Note that they cap at level 10.
